Firing seminar in Coquitlam generates interest
The whys and wherefores of hiring and firing people is the topic next week during a Tri-Cities Chamber of Commerce 101 Seminar.
Angela Podgorska, an associate at McQuarrie Hunter LLP, will talk about how to navigate the often challenging and complicated area of terminating employees — what to watch out for and how best to avoid liability.
This seminar is so popular that it's being moved to a larger venue: the Fraser Room of the City of Coquitlam Innovation Centre (downstairs from the Tri-Cities Chamber of Commerce office).
The date is still Wednesday, Sept. 19 from 8-9:30 p.m.
